Elayna Black Announces She Is Taking A Break From Wrestling For The Foreseeable Future

Elayna Black (formerly Cora Jade) announced she is taking a break from wrestling for the foreseeable future.

Black had been making independent wrestling appearances following her WWE release in May.

I originally had a 10 minute long video explaining where my head’s at, and maybe eventually l’ll post it but seems unnecessary for now. I’ll keep it short but I am going to be taking a break from wrestling for the foreseeable future. It’s no longer good for my mental health and I’ll never know if that love for it I once had will return if I don’t step away. I’m gonna take the rest of the year to take care of me and go from there. I apologize to the fans and promoters who were looking forward to/booked my upcoming appearances. I hope you can understand. To my supporters, thank you

-Brie/Elayna
“Let go or be dragged”

Elayna Black last wrestled at Prestige Combat Clash ’25 on July 13, teaming with Brooke Havok against The IInspiration (Cassie Lee & Jessica McKay). She had been competing for GCW, AIW, and other independent promotions. Black competed as Cora Jade in WWE from in 2021 to 2025 before her release.

Fightful wishes Elayna the best in her future.
